Second Half Rally Lifts SU To CAC Title

The Salisbury University women’s lacrosse overcame a very slow start to rally in the second half to earn a 8-7 win over York to advance to the CAC Championship game. The win improves the Sea Gulls to 15-2 on the year. 

The Spartans would come out of the gates and build a 4-1 lead less than 15 minutes into the game. Finally, the Sea Gulls would seem to find their rhythm, getting an easy score off a free position shot from Hannah Young. Then Dana King would work in a pretty goal late in the half, spinning back towards the near post and firing low past the keeper. SU then went on a good run to open up the second half, getting goals from Emma Wall, Allie Hynson and Gabrielle Mongno. The Spartans would answer and the teams would find themselves tied again with under 10 minutes to go. That’s when SU would take the lead for good, off a goal from Megan Wallenhorst.

The Sea Gulls now advance to the CAC Title game which will be played next Saturday.
